Crawlspace Foundation Repair in Woodbury, CT
Crawlspace foundation repair services address issues related to the structural integrity and stability of the area beneath a home. These projects typically involve fixing sagging or damaged beams, replacing rotted or compromised supports, and correcting uneven or settling foundations. Property owners often seek these services when noticing symptoms such as uneven flooring, cracks in walls or ceilings, or increased moisture and mold growth in the crawlspace area. Proper repair helps prevent further damage to the home’s structure and can improve indoor air quality by reducing excess humidity and mold.
Before requesting crawlspace foundation repair, homeowners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the causes behind foundation issues, and the types of repair options available. It’s important to assess whether the problem stems from soil movement, moisture intrusion, or other factors. Clarifying the scope of work, the materials used, and the potential impact on property value can help property owners make informed decisions. Proper evaluation ensures that repairs effectively address the root causes and provide long-term stability for the home.

Common Crawlspace Foundation Repair Jobs
Crawlspace foundation repair involves stabilizing and reinforcing the support structure beneath a home.
Vapor barrier installation helps control moisture and prevent mold growth in crawlspaces.
Pier and beam repair addresses sagging or uneven floors caused by foundation issues.
Post and beam stabilization provides added support to prevent shifting and settlement.
Drainage solutions redirect water away from the foundation to reduce erosion and damage.
Structural reinforcement strengthens compromised crawlspace supports to maintain home stability.
Crawlspace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, cracked walls, musty odors, and visible sagging or bowing of the foundation walls.
How does crawlspace foundation repair improve a home? Repairs help stabilize the foundation, prevent further damage, and reduce issues like mold and pest intrusion.
What methods are used for crawlspace foundation repair? Common approaches include wall stabilization, underpinning, and installing piers or supports to lift and reinforce the foundation.
Is crawlspace foundation repair necessary for all types of foundation damage? Repair is recommended when signs of structural instability or water intrusion are present to maintain home safety and integrity.
